French Vogue to Become More Frugal in Response to the Global Recession
French Vogue editor-in-chief Carine Roitfeld has called for French Vogue to become frugal to reflect the current economic recession. “I think we need to become more frugal,” claims Roitfeld, though “[not] on quality [...] just on organization.” Carine Roitfeld is considered by many to be one of the most fashionable women in the world, only [...]

Michelle Obama Lands March Vogue Cover
First Lady Michelle Obama will be featured on Vogue Magazine’s March cover. The news is hardly a surprise given the rumors and speculation that have been circling ever since Barak Obama was elected President in November. While Vogue traditionally features incoming first ladies, this marks only the second time the new First Lady has been [...]
